Accountants keep track of, analyze and archive an organization’s financial information. Depending on the size of the organization, accountants are also sometimes asked to give advice on how an organization should budget, spend and invest its money. The jobs- and compensation ... Four-Year Plan. Associate Dean: Dr. Joseph Bailey. Assistant Dean: Brian Horick. Finance encompasses: Corporate finance: The financial management of corporations. Investments: The management of securities and portfolios. Financial institutions and markets: The management of financial institutions and the study of their role in the economy.With a finance degree, you can prepare for a career as a financial planner, financial analyst, commercial banker, investment manager, and more.
